These figures represent the likelihood, as perceived by oddsmakers, of a specific individual being appointed to a head coaching position in the National Football League. For example, if a candidate has odds of +200, a bet of $100 would yield a profit of $200 should that individual secure the coaching role. Conversely, negative odds, such as -150, indicate that a bet of $150 is required to win $100. These numbers are dynamic, fluctuating in response to news, rumors, and betting activity.

The lines offered for the initial two quarters of a professional football game represent a specific segment of wagering options. These differ from full-game lines, focusing solely on the score accumulated during the first 30 minutes of play. For example, a bookmaker might set the point spread for the first half with one team favored by a certain number of points, requiring that team to lead by more than that margin at halftime for the wager to be successful.

The betting lines established specifically for the second half of a National Football League (NFL) game represent wagering opportunities distinct from those offered before the game’s commencement or at halftime. These odds reflect the bookmakers’ assessment of how the remainder of the contest is likely to unfold, taking into account the score at halftime, any significant injuries, and overall game momentum. For example, if Team A is leading Team B by 10 points at halftime, the second half line might favor Team B by 3 points, suggesting oddsmakers anticipate Team B will outscore Team A in the second half, though not necessarily win the game outright.

The availability of these betting opportunities provides an avenue for bettors to capitalize on perceived miscalculations or shifts in game dynamics. The second-half line can be significantly influenced by coaching adjustments, changes in player performance, and unexpected events occurring in the first half. Its emergence as a popular wagering option stems from the desire to react to live game information rather than relying solely on pre-game projections, offering a more dynamic and responsive approach to NFL betting strategy.
